As someone with dry skin, I usually feel dryness and deep tightness when cleansing with foam in the morning. However, with this product, I hardly noticed any dryness. It removes the uncomfortable oiliness, leaving my skin feeling fresh yet hydrated. I also appreciated the cool gel texture, which helped lower my skin temperature during cleansing. Those who prefer cleansers with strong cleansing effectiveness or have oily skin might find this product's cleansing power insufficient. However, that's precisely why I like it, and I'm already on my second bottle. I'm writing this review because some of the other reviews seem clueless. This product is meant for morning cleansing to remove excess oil and add hydration - it's not a typical cleansing foam. Its primary purpose is for makeup removal and morning cleansing. It's not designed for deep cleansing power, folks. You use it on bare skin, almost like a cleansing gel, get it? The effect is that when you use it in the morning, gently massaging it onto your bare face and then rinsing, your skin becomes super smooth and hydrated. The price can be a bit of a hurdle.
